Mastering the Art of Cocktails at 12 Rocks

At the heart of 12 Rocks Beach Bar's allure are its cocktails—masterpieces crafted by award-winning mixologists who draw from Australia's rich botanical heritage. The bar's menu boasts over 30 signature drinks, each designed to complement the coastal setting. From sunrise spritzes to midnight martinis, the selection caters to every palate and occasion.

Signature Cocktails That Define Coastal Indulgence

The star of the show is the "Rockpool Martini," a blend of native gin, fresh finger limes, and a hint of sea salt harvested from nearby shores. This drink captures the essence of the ocean in a glass, with its citrusy zing balanced by subtle brininess. For something sweeter, the "Sunset Lagoon" combines rum, passionfruit, and hibiscus syrup, served in a hollowed-out pineapple for that tropical flair.

Non-alcoholic options are equally impressive, ensuring inclusivity. The "Wave Rider" mocktail, made with cucumber, mint, and sparkling elderflower, refreshes without compromise. Mixologists often host interactive sessions, where guests learn to muddle herbs or shake infusions, turning a drink into a memorable activity.

What elevates these cocktails is the emphasis on fresh, local ingredients. Australian bartenders at 12 Rocks source spirits from distilleries like Archie Rose in Sydney, infusing global techniques with down-under flavors. Prices are reasonable for the quality—most cocktails range from AUD 18 to 25—making it accessible for casual visitors.

Savoring the Freshest Seafood Delights

No visit to 12 Rocks is complete without indulging in its seafood offerings, renowned as some of Australia's finest. The kitchen prides itself on hyper-local sourcing, with daily catches from sustainable fisheries along the coast. Chef-led menus change with the seasons, ensuring peak freshness and variety.

A Menu Inspired by the Ocean

Start with appetizers like seared scallops drizzled in yuzu butter or king prawn cocktails served in chilled rock salt bowls—a nod to the bar's name. Main courses shine with grilled barramundi fillets, accompanied by native greens and a side of hand-cut chips. For shellfish lovers, the seafood platter is legendary: mud crabs, Sydney rock oysters, and balmain bugs, all presented on beds of ice with lemon wedges and housemade sauces.

Vegetarian and gluten-free options abound, such as grilled halloumi with heirloom tomatoes or quinoa salads with roasted veggies. Desserts incorporate coastal twists, like pavlova topped with passionfruit curd and fresh mango.

Portions are generous, and presentation is Instagram-worthy, with edible flowers and sea glass accents. The open kitchen allows diners to watch the action, adding theater to the meal. Prices reflect the premium quality—mains hover around AUD 35-50—but value is evident in the sourcing and execution.
